Andy McCollum received a pleasant surprise during his recent Summit County Sports Hall of Fame induction.

A retired Super Bowl-winning offensive lineman , McCollum thought his former Revere High School football head coach, Joe Pappano , would likely attend the banquet on Oct. 7 in Akron.

However, McCollum didn’t know Pappano would coordinate with Revere’s administration and assemble a larger contingent. Pappano and four of his old Minutemen assistant coaches showed up to support McCollum, who traveled from his home in Eureka, Missouri, for the ceremony .
